Notes from the Thoughtworks Future of Software Development Retreat covering several AI-related themes. Key discussions include harness engineering and context management for LLMs, the growing interest in self-hosted open-weight models driven by cost, sovereignty, and security concerns, and the 'Bring Me a Rock' session exploring whether non-engineers should be allowed to steer AI agents. The retreat's overarching theme, articulated by Kief Morris, was the question of how much autonomy to grant agents and how to maintain confidence in their outputs. Additional links cover local model setups (Qwen 3.6 as a sweet spot), tips for saving costs with Anthropic's Fable model, the impact of AI on developer education revenue, and a critique of Claude's Electron-based desktop app.
